The ingredients needed to make Crockpot: Afghan style potato cauliflower and rice:
  1. Take 100 grams butter for olive oil
  2. Take 3 brown onions peeled diced 5 mm
  3. Take 4 cloves garlic, peeled, crushed or finally chopped
  4. Make ready 1 tablespoon cumin seeds
  5. Make ready 1 tablespoon garam masala
  6. Take 1 tablespoon ground cardamom
  7. Get 1 medium cauliflower
  8. Get 3 potatoes, peeled and diced 2 cm
  9. Get 1 Tablespoon salt
  10. Take 400 g tinned, chopped tomatoes
  11. Take 2 tablespoons vegetable stock powder
  12. Get 240 ml water
  13. Prepare Pinch saffron threads
  14. Take Carrot current topping
  15. Prepare 3 small or medium carrots cut into fine match sticks
  16. Get 180 gram currents
  17. Get 3 tablespoons sugar
  18. Prepare 120 ml water
  19. Take Basmati rice
  20. Take Pistachios
  21. Make ready Greek yogurt
  22. Make ready 1 bunch coriander

Instructions to make Crockpot: Afghan style potato cauliflower and rice:
  1. Put the carrots, currents, sugar and water into the pot. Set to simmer and press Start/stop. Cook until the carrots are just tender and current plump. Press start/stop and set aside.
  2. Select brown/salty and press start/stop. Combined the oil, onions, garlic, cumin, garam masala, cardamom and salt in the cooker. Cook until onions are softened and slightly golden and spices are fragrant.
  3. Stir in the cauliflower, potatoes, salt, saffron,stock powder, saffron and water. Secure the lid, ensure the steam release dial is seal/closed and select rise/grains. Press start/stop.
  4. When cooking has finished, release the steam and remove the lid. Taste and season with more salt and pepper if needed. To serve, spoon some rice and the vegetables in the bowl. Sprinkle a tablespoon of the carrot current mix and also pistachios on top, then a dollop of Greek style yogurt and fresh coriander over each serving.
